Centennial, Colorado

Centennial is a city located in the state of Colorado, United States. As of the most recent census, the city has a population of 100,377, making it one of the most populous cities in the state.

Demographics[edit | edit source]

Centennial is a diverse city with a variety of ethnicities and age groups. The city's population is spread out, with a median age of 37.4 years.

Health[edit | edit source]

According to the CDC, the adult obesity rate in Centennial was 20.6% in 2017. This is slightly lower than the national average, but still represents a significant public health concern.
